使用 zenity 进度条和 bzcat 进行 dd 复制

使用 zenity 进度条和 bzcat 进行 dd 复制

我知道有方法可以添加进度条dd,但我似乎无法找到适合我具体情况的方法。以下是我目前所拥有的:

bzcat /file/path/goes/here.dd.bz2 | pv -n | dd of=/dev/sdx | zenity --progress --text="Writing" --percentage=0 --auto-close

我似乎什么都做不了。进度条要么停留在 0 直到dd完成,要么上升 2 并很快完成。任何意见都值得赞赏。

相关内容